Once 755145 is fixed, we should be able to reenable ccache on OS X. The question is finding out if it is profitable. How should we benchmark this?

I just noticed I posted the benchmark to the wrong bug :-) What I got locally on my laptop with a 10GB cache was
ccache build 1 with empty cache
real 36m40.916s
user 99m18.844s
sys 12m22.869s
ccache build 2 empty objdir, but full cache
real 11m53.582s
user 9m9.587s
sys 3m22.222s
no ccache
real 32m11.518s
user 90m58.849s
sys 8m43.691s

The times differences are:
opt: 78 m -> 87 m
32 bit debug: 62 m -> 66 m
64 bit debug: 56 m -> 61 m
So we do need some numbers showing that we get a good cache hit ratio to justify this. Do we log the try build times somewhere?

I am still getting a 24 minute average on os x :-(
#!/usr/bin/python
import json
f = file('builds-2012-07-19.js')
data = json.load(f)
builds = data['builds']
try_builds = [x for x in builds if x['properties']['branch']=='try']
successful_try_builds = [x for x in try_builds if x['result'] == 0]
os_x_names = set(['macosx', 'macosx64', 'lion', 'macosx-debug',
'macosx64-debug', 'snowleopard', 'leopard'])
successful_os_x_try_builds = [x for x in successful_try_builds if
x['properties']['platform'] in os_x_names]
times = [x['endtime'] - x['starttime'] for x in successful_os_x_try_builds]
print (float(sum(times))/len(times))/60

The hit rate looks good:
https://tbpl.mozilla.org/php/getParsedLog.php?id=13737534&tree=Try&full=1
cache directory /builds/ccache
cache hit (direct) 4683
cache hit (preprocessed) 101
cache miss 23
called for link 31
called for preprocessing 8
compile failed 1
preprocessor error 1
bad compiler arguments 1
unsupported source language 3
autoconf compile/link 24
unsupported compiler option 120
no input file 7
files in cache 32914
cache size 1.4 Gbytes
max cache size 10.0 Gbytes
